No. 411 R E S O L U T I O N WHEREAS, An inspiring couple whose lives have been enhanced by a great and enduring love, Mack and Julia Johnson of Quitman celebrated their 60th wedding anniversary on July 17, 2014; and WHEREAS, Mack Johnson and the former Julia Faye Kirbo were united in matrimony at First Baptist Church in Quitman in 1954; through the years, they became the parents of four children, Marty, Donal, David, and the late Debra Kay, and today, their family has grown to include two daughters-in-law, Pam and Anita, as well as four grandchildren, Bobby, Kyle, Janelle, and Amber, and two great-grandchildren, Kimberlee and Noah; and WHEREAS, Respected members of their community, the couple have resided in the Quitman area for the entirety of their married lives; and WHEREAS, While much has changed in the world over the past six decades, this devoted husband and wife have remained constant in their commitment to each other, and the strength of their love has enabled them to meet life's challenges and opportunities with grace and optimism; now, therefore, be it RESOLVED, That the House of Representatives of the 84th Texas Legislature hereby congratulate Mack and Julia Johnson on their 60th wedding anniversary and extend to them sincere best wishes for continued happiness; and, be it further RESOLVED, That an official copy of this resolution be prepared for the couple as an expression of high regard by the Texas House of Representatives.
